The Return of the Halloween Cake

Back in the 1950s through to the early 1990s, local bakeries such as City Bakeries produced these autumnal treats in abundance. They consisted of a soft sponge, coloured fondant icing with a scary face, and a cream-filled centre plus butter-cream filled “cheeks”.

Why It Matters

For many Glaswegians, that cake wasn’t just dessert, it was part of the city’s childhood memory bank. The phrase “You’ve got a face like a Halloween cake” became one of those affectionate insults.
